Job summary

Branch: Gas Affiliation: IBEW Employment Status: Full-Time Regular Salary: $45.05 Hourly Short-term Incentive Eligible: Yes Workplace Flexibility: No Posting End Date: Open until filled As the province’s largest energy provider with more than 100 years of knowledge and experience, we proudly deliver renewable energy, natural gas, electricity and propane to 1.3 million customers. Responsibilities Prepare layouts, cut and shape metal components, and assemble finished products using tools, heavy duty machines, and welding processes. Work with engineering drawings, sketches, or original parts and, if required, produce accurate working drawings or sketches or components. Fabricate and repair a range of tools and equipment. Use of manual and/or power operated tools and machines relevant to metal fabrication and forming. Performs other duties and responsibilities as assigned. Requirements Minimum two (2) years of metal fabrication experience in a manufacturing or industrial environment. Ability to become proficient in interpreting work orders, mechanical drawings, sketches and written instruction and record work done. Demonstrated safe work habits and adherence to safety regulations and practices on a sustained basis. Demonstrated mechanical aptitude.
